Output d19fdad7c71734ea6c9919310ba1a8c1fecdda1e063a7564ccb20ff756ef9911:1

value
668690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 054ba6f63b678a896a101df3148edfe63591295c OP_EQUAL
address
32B1vuhxmtzkF9KkfFB6ZBDTKqBmYs1HsZ
transaction
d19fdad7c71734ea6c9919310ba1a8c1fecdda1e063a7564ccb20ff756ef9911
spent
true